Nelson man faces meth charges

A Lovingston man out on bond for previous drug charges was arrested Friday after Nelson County deputies found more than a pound and a half of methamphetamine at his residence, the sheriff said on Monday.
Charles William Spencer III, 35, was charged with four felonies and two misdemeanors after a search warrant was served on his residence at 112 Barn Hill Lane in Lovingston.
Spencer was charged with possession with intent to manufacture of a schedule I or schedule II substance, distribution or possession with intent of less than half an ounce of marijuana, eluding and endangering police, possession of a gun with schedule I or schedule II drug, and two counts of the manufacture or sale of a controlled substance.
Nelson County Sheriff David Brooks said that during a traffic stop in May, authorities found three ounces of methamphetamine, Vicodin pills and more than a quarter ounce of marijuana in Spencer’s possession.
He was charged with possession with intent to sell, distribution of a schedule III drug and distribution or possession with intent of marijuana, records show. His trial date is set for Oct. 10.
Last week’s search warrant came after more than six months of investigation, Brooks said. He said Spencer was suspected of purchasing methamphetamine elsewhere and distributing it within the county.
Nelson County deputies also seized seven guns, three vehicles and more than $500 in cash during the search. Brooks said the methamphetamine was valued at more than $41,000.
Four other Nelson residents were arrested Friday after they went to Spencer’s residence while deputies conducted the search, Brooks said.
- Jason Bryant, 23, of Wingina, was charged with unauthorized distribution of controlled drug paraphernalia.
- Thomas Massie Huffman, 30, of Lovingston, was charged with possession of a schedule I or schedule II substance.
- Jeffrey Simpson, 22, of Tyro, was charged with possession of marijuana.
- Tabitha Hall, 22, of Tyro, was also charged with possession of marijuana.
Spencer is set to appear in court on Aug. 14 at 1:30 p.m.
